Windows NT/2000 Native API Reference

 
Windows NT/2000 Native API Reference

Description

For courses in Windows NT and Windows 2000 Programming.

A must have resource for any programming student developing application for the Windows platform. The Windows NT/2000 Native API Reference provides the first comprehensive look at the undocumented services that are part of the native API set. A unique tool for software developers, this reference includes documentation of more than 200 routines included in the native API; detailed description of routines that are either not directly accessible via the Win32 API, or that offer substantial additional functionality; example library routines and utility programs demonstrating the functionality of particular routines; and coverage of kernel architecture supporting the debugging of user mode applications.
